Sen. Saxby Chambliss (R-GA) joined several Republicans and one Democrat in filibustering the nomination of John Brennan for CIA director on the Senate floor Wednesday. Sen. Rand Paul (R-KY) began the “talking” filibuster over the issue of drone warfare.

“I will speak until I can no longer speak,” Paul said. “I will speak as long as it takes, until the alarm is sounded from coast to coast that our Constitution is important, that your rights to trial by jury are precious, that no American should be killed by a drone on American soil without first being charged with a crime, without first being found to be guilty by a court.”
